How do these loans work?
If you are a motorsports enthusiast, boater or RV lover and need to finance the purchase of your dream vehicle, there are several options available to you. One option is a loan designed specifically for motorcycles, boats or RVs (recreational vehicles).
Once you have decided on a loan, you need to fill out an application and submit the necessary documents. Usually this includes proof of income, credit score and a description of the vehicle you want to buy.
If your credit score is good and you meet the requirements, your bank or lender will approve your loan and disburse the amount to you. When you receive the money, you can purchase the vehicle and begin making payments according to the terms of the loan.
- Some factors that can affect credit are the purchase price of the vehicle, the annual interest rate and their credit score.
- Carefully review the terms of your agreement, such as the loan term, monthly payments and interest rate, before signing the contract.
- If you pay off the loan early, you may be able to save money and reduce interest rates.

Tips for applying for a motorcycle, boat or RV loan
If you’re thinking about buying a motorcycle, boat or RV but lack the wherewithal, a loan may be a good option. Here are some tips that can help you find the right loan:
- Compare different loan offers: Before you decide on a loan offer, compare different options. Compare interest rates, terms and fees from different lenders to find the best deal.
- Check your credit score: Your credit score has a big impact on your ability to get a loan and the interest rate you pay. Check your credit score and improve it if necessary before applying for a loan.
- Make sure the loan fits your budget: make sure the monthly payments fit your budget and that you can afford the loan. It would be unwise to apply for a loan that is out of your budget and a burden on your monthly income.
